US troops 'withdraw from Yemen' | US troops 'withdraw from Yemen' |
(about 2 hours later) | |
The US is withdrawing its military personnel from a base in Yemen because of increasing insecurity there, Yemeni sources say. | The US is withdrawing its military personnel from a base in Yemen because of increasing insecurity there, Yemeni sources say. |
About 100 troops, including special forces commandos, are leaving al-Anad air base near the southern city of al-Houta, the officials said. | About 100 troops, including special forces commandos, are leaving al-Anad air base near the southern city of al-Houta, the officials said. |
The city was stormed by al-Qaeda fighters on Friday, although they were later driven out by the Yemeni army. | The city was stormed by al-Qaeda fighters on Friday, although they were later driven out by the Yemeni army. |
The US military has not confirmed the evacuation. | The US military has not confirmed the evacuation. |
It comes a day after suicide bombers killed at least 137 people in the capital Sanaa.
